Forms of Child Care
There are several kinds of childcare readily available near myself, including Daycare Near Me By State centers, home-based treatment, and preschool programs. Daycare facilities are generally big facilities that may accommodate a large number of children, while home-based attention providers work from their very own houses. Preschool programs are created to prepare young ones for kindergarten and past, with a focus on very early knowledge and socialization.
Each kind of childcare features its own pros and cons. Daycare centers provide a structured environment with skilled staff and educational activities, nevertheless they are pricey and may even have traditionally waiting listings. Home-based attention providers provide an even more customized and flexible approach, but might not have similar amount of supervision as daycare facilities. Preschool programs provide a strong educational foundation for the kids, but might not be ideal for all households due to cost or area.
Benefits of Child Care
Childcare offers numerous benefits for the kids and people. Studies have shown that young ones which attend high-quality child care programs will succeed academically and socially later on in life. Child care in addition provides moms and dads with peace of mind, comprehending that their children are in a safe and nurturing environment while they have reached work.
In addition, childcare will help kiddies develop essential social and psychological skills, such as empathy, collaboration, and conflict quality. Kiddies which attend child care programs likewise have the chance to interact with colleagues from diverse backgrounds, assisting them develop a feeling of threshold and acceptance.
Difficulties of Child Care
Despite its many benefits, child care additionally gift suggestions difficulties for households. One of the biggest difficulties could be the price of child care, which can be prohibitively costly for several families. Furthermore, finding high-quality child care near me personally can be tough, particularly in areas with restricted options.
Another challenge may be the possibility turnover among childcare providers, which could disrupt the stability and continuity of look after kiddies. Additionally, some households may have concerns towards quality of care provided in some child care settings, ultimately causing anxiety and doubt about their child's well-being.
